The Purple Rose Inn module is a fully functioning inn that can be used as a base to any module and added to fit into the worlds you DM.
I was frustrated with the way NWN handled sleeping and that you could sleep anywhere any number of times. I spent the last several weeks scripting out an inn that players would have to rest in if they were in town. If they are not in town, they have to use bedrolls and have food.
I believe this to be a great addition to the game and wanted to make it available to the public so that more people could take advantage of it. I have designed the module to be used as a base and have other builders or DM?s add to it to fit into their campaign. For this reason, the module only has a few areas areas.
This module depends on the Hard Core Rule set by Archaegeo and can be downloaded from his website at: http://nwn.darkemud.com/~darke/HC/index.htm

Mr. Bungle,
Load the module with the area you want to export. Click
on the file menu and then choose export. Change the type of
file you want to export to area by opening the drop down
box. Select the area and then select export. Once you're
done there, open up your module you want to export the area
to and select import from the file menu. Select the ERF
file you made and push okay. That should do it.

It would be possible to make a version of the PRI that
doesn't use HCR. All you'd have to do is edit the
pri_on_play_rest script and remove all the references
there to the HCR. You'd also have to make an on Enter
script that looks like the hc_inc_on_enter script. If you
guys need help with that, e-mail me.
I'm only releasing an HCR version though.
